most popular motivational books

  • The Alchemist

    by Paulo Coelho: This story follows a young shepherd boy on his journey to find treasure buried near the Pyramids of Egypt. Along the way, he learns about the importance of following one's dreams and listening to one's heart.

  • The 7 Habits of Highly Effective People

    by Stephen Covey: This book outlines a practical seven-step plan for personal and professional success. It teaches readers how to be proactive, think win-win, and put first things first.

  • Think and Grow Rich

    by Napoleon Hill: This book is a classic self-help book that teaches readers how to achieve their financial goals. It is based on the belief that anyone can achieve anything they want if they set their mind to it.

  • The Power of Positive Thinking

    by Norman Vincent Peale: This book teaches readers how to use positive thinking to overcome challenges and achieve their goals. It is based on the belief that we can create our own reality through our thoughts and beliefs.

  • You Are a Badass: How to Stop Doubting Your Greatness and Start Living an Awesome Life

    by Jen Sincero: This book is a no-nonsense guide to self-love and empowerment. It teaches readers how to overcome self-doubt and live their best lives.

  • The Subtle Art of Not Giving a F*ck

    by Mark Manson: This book challenges conventional wisdom about happiness and success. It argues that we should focus on what is important to us and not waste time worrying about things that we can't control.

  • Grit: The Power of Passion and Perseverance

    by Angela Duckworth: This book examines the role of grit in success. It argues that grit is more important than talent for achieving long-term goals.

  • Atomic Habits: An Easy & Proven Way to Build Good Habits & Break Bad Ones

    by James Clear: This book provides a science-based approach to habit formation. It teaches readers how to create small, sustainable changes that will lead to big results over time.

  • Man's Search for Meaning

    by Viktor Frankl: This book is a memoir of Frankl's experiences in Nazi concentration camps. It explores the importance of finding meaning in life, even in the darkest of times.
